Records describing books, pamphlets and serials, amassed since 1824, by the Historical Society of Pennsylvania (HSP).

The Society's collections center on eastern Pennsylvania, southern New Jersey, and parts of Delaware and Maryland, but also include a wealth of materials on the eastern United States, the founding of this country, and the diversity of ethnic and immigrant experiences across the United States. The Balch Institute for Ethnic Studies merged with HSP in 2002. |
